The Causes and Health Consequences of Iron Excess in the Body

Do you or someone you love suffer from arthritis, depression, chronic fatigue, hair loss, heart arrythmia, infertility, Alzheimer's disease or autism? Did you know iron excess or iron toxicity can be a contributing factor in the above health issues and more?

This webinar will discuss the complexities of iron metabolism, shedding light on topics such as:

• The importance of iron in the body and its various forms
• Factors affecting iron absorption, including dietary sources and genetic variants
• The role of iron in many common chronic diseases and its impact on overall health
• Understanding hemochromatosis: a genetic disorder causing excess iron
• Practical tips for maintaining optimal iron levels
